Output 3764965450625cf57f69d79bdb911323575792450c2962027a151a942204175d:55

value
93129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c994d0e661f5801107dec6933354cd4130ce820 OP_EQUAL
address
3Fy2z1WUqLyWNaaFF8EJzpcNwRwJYpYMGF
transaction
3764965450625cf57f69d79bdb911323575792450c2962027a151a942204175d
spent
true